Slave to the Rhythm
This is what Edith Piaf used to say: “Use your faults, use your defects, then you are going to be a star…”
Slave to the Rhythm – Grace Jones – 1985
Although originally intended for Frankie Goes To Hollywood as a follow up to Relax, Trevor Horn eventually gave the project to Jones who truly made it into the timeless work of art it is.
